Get Your Tech License The Easy Way

So you want to get some real commo gear and stop using those walkie talkies from Walmart? This means Ham Radio.

Ham Radio requires a license to do it legally. So you might say “I don’t need no stinking license”. You could go that route, but you will never acquire the skills you need to be effective in radio without lots of practice and practice means airtime. Hams WILL KNOW IF YOU ARE NOT LICENSED and it just will not go well for you. Get your tech license, it is easy and will give you access to many bands including the much used 2M and 440mhz.

You decided? Great!

OK, here is the free tech study guide. If you read it with the idea that it come DIRECTLY from the test, it makes sense and will give you the basics.

https://www.kb6nu.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/11/2018-no-nonsense-tech-study-guide-v1-1.pdf

Now, once you read it, really read and digest it, then you start flash cards. Online flash cards do two things very well, they drill into your brain the actual questions and answers from the exam, and they give you instant feedback as to your answers. Positive reinforcement.

Do the cards for an hour or so each night or give yourself a break of a few hours if more than once per day so you don’t burn out, and you will be able to pass the test.

There are two flash card sites I recommend (you can also take practice exams).

https://hamstudy.org/tech2018

https://hamexam.org/

And another place to take practice exams

http://www.eham.net/exams/

Do a google search for (your county, state)ham exam and you can find where the test is being given. Many Ham clubs offer testing and the cost is $15. While you’re at it, go ahead and study for your General test as well, you can take it for free the same night. I passed both on one evening and you can too. It’s easy if you spend a few nights with the flash cards to get your Tech license and even General license.

The General study guide is $9.97 and well worth it.

I have personally tested $30 Chinese dual band handhelds in the mountains of NC, over hills and forest at over 6 miles. I was not at the end of their range. Yes, they are line of sight and it depends on your terrain but 5w Chinese dual bands beat the heck out of 1w FRS radios from Walmart.

With repeaters many miles of useful communication is available. The big 2M tower in my area has a huge footprint at 1800 feet high and I have hit it from my truck at over 75 miles away.

Get on it, nothing good happens without comms.

Get. Your. License. 10 year old boys and girls get their tech license every month where I live, you can do it, with a few nights of study.

Pope Francis confirms priests’ abuse of nuns included “sexual slavery”

Nuns have suffered and are still suffering sexual abuse at the hands of Catholic priests and bishops, and have even been held as sexual slaves, Pope Francis confirmed on Tuesday. The abuse was so severe in one case that an entire congregation of nuns was dissolved by former Pope Benedict.

The scope of the abuse of nuns by clergy members first came to light with the publication at the beginning of February of the monthly Vatican magazine “Women Church World.” The edition included Francis’ own take on the scandal — long known about by the Vatican but virtually never discussed — in which he blamed the unchecked power wielded by priests and higher clergy across the Catholic Church for such crimes.  

An Associated Press journalist who first reported on the scandal last year asked Pope Francis on his flight home from the Arabian Peninsula on Tuesday whether enough was being done by the Church hierarchy to address the problem.

The pontiff conceded that it was a problem and said more action was needed. He insisted the will to confront the abuse is there, and stressed that the problem is not new, and that the Church has been working to address it for some time.

What Are You Reading?

A 4GW READING LIST

As the nation-state system goes through its death throes, our own government has admitted that the world is undergoing “Lebanonization.”  For no other reason than that, I think it’s a good idea to understand 4th-Generation warfare in all its forms.  Personally, I felt most of my officer training was useless for war in the world of the declining nation-state, so this topic is of academic interest to me.  In each of these books, question the assumptions and correlate the assumption with those of other authors.  These books are not ranked in order.

  1. Victoria by Bill Lind. A novel about 4th generation war in the United States.  Regardless of what you believe about its premises, it’s an excellent, thought-provoking read about the establishment of insurgency, legitimacy, and prosecution of 4th-generation war in various regions of the former United States.  It has excellent summaries of key ideas of military strategists (Moltke, et al) and philosophers (the Frankfurt School) that influenced the outbreak of insurgency in the United States, for good or bad.  Lind gives an excellent definition of strategy in Victoria from one of Boyd’s talks. He said strategy is the art of connecting yourself to as many other power centers as possible, while separating your enemy from as many power centers as possible.
  2. American Insurgents; American Patriots by Breen. It examines the countryside insurgency that evicted the British occupation from the countryside and bottled it up in the cities.  The interesting thing was the way the insurgency established a larger organization among the 13 colonies and avoided anarchy and established legitimacy. I’m halfway through.  This book is a slog but gives the background of one of the few insurgencies run by good people to good results.  Most insurgencies are by bad people towards bad results.
  3. The Fangs of the Lone Wolf: Chechen tactics in the Russian-Chechen wars 1994-2009. The forward states that “what is lacking in the literature about the guerrilla perspective are collections of the combat experiences of the rank and file guerrillas and their tactical leaders. These people seldom leave written records, yet theirs are often the most interesting accounts.” This book contains stories from rank-and-file guerrillas.
